
Cost of Veranda Construction in Petaluma
Constructing a veranda in Petaluma, CA, can significantly enhance your outdoor living space, providing a perfect spot for relaxation and entertainment. However, the cost of building a veranda can vary widely depending on several factors. Understanding these factors and the typical expenses involved can help you budget appropriately for your project.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size: Larger verandas require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Materials: The choice of materials, such as wood, metal, or composite, impacts the price.
- Design Complexity: Custom designs with intricate details can be more expensive than simple, standard designs.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Petaluma can vary, affecting the total cost of construction.
- Permits and Inspections: Obtaining necessary permits and passing inspections can add to the cost.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the construction site, including any required leveling or clearing, influences the price.
- Additional Features: Extras like lighting, railings, or built-in seating can increase cost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Petaluma, CA) |
---|---|
Site Preparation | $500 - $1,500 |
Basic Veranda Construction | $5,000 - $15,000 |
Premium Materials Upgrade | $2,000 - $7,000 |
Custom Design Features | $1,000 - $5,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$200 - $800 |
Labor (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
